‘Gatta Kusthi 2’ box office collections day 5: Aishwarya Lekshmi and Vishnu Vishal’s film sees minor dip; Worldwide total reaches Rs 25.64 cr

‘Gatta Kusthi 2’, starring Vishnu Vishal and Aishwarya Lekshmi, continued its box office journey with a small decline in collections on its fifth day.According to Sacnilk, the film collected Rs 2.20 crore net in India on Day 5. This represents a 6.4% drop from the Rs 2.35 crore earned on Day 4.

India total moves past Rs 18 crore

The latest collections have taken ‘Gatta Kusthi 2’ to Rs 18.40 crore in India net collections. The film’s India gross collection has also increased to Rs 21.14 crore. On Tuesday, the film was screened across 2,201 shows nationwide.

Worldwide gross reaches Rs 25.64 crore

On Day 5, it earned Rs 50 lakhs from international markets. The film’s total overseas gross has climbed to Rs 4.50 crore.’ Gatta Kusthi 2′ has now reached a worldwide gross collection of Rs 25.64 crore.The Tamil version recorded an overall occupancy of 22.38% on Day 5. Morning shows registered 15.46% occupancy before audience turnout improved during the afternoon.Afternoon occupancy stood at 20.77% and evening shows recorded 18.77%. Night shows had an impressive 31.77% occupancy.The sequel is directed by Chella Ayyavu. ‘Gatta Kusthi 2’ takes forward the story established in the 2022 hit ‘Gatta Kusthi’. Aishwarya Lekshmi once again plays the role of a wrestler, while Vishnu Vishal reprises his character. The sequel centres on the lead couple as they navigate a new phase in their lives, with the husband honouring his promise to support his wife’s wrestling career.ETimes reviewed the film with the following verdict: “Chella Ayyavu fused the commercial rural drama formula of the ’90s with political correctness of the 2020s in Gatta Kusthi, an entertaining comedy drama.
